Runbook — Reservoir sample runs (Harkell Water Co.)

Quick reminders for the shift lead: the Grenfold Reservoir samples come in twice weekly, usually mid-morning. Coolers go straight to the chilled bay — don't let them sit on the dock. Check seals, initial the manifest, and ping the lab so someone's ready. If a bottle's cracked, bag it and log it. Courier hand-over instruction is below.

handover note for yagef-bagep: the drudor pelius courier leaves the kasdor zorvan norir ledger at gate 8016 under passcode 755406

MEMO — Tessler & Vane, Internal Only

To: Branch Managers
Re: Hiring Freeze, Fieldworks Division

Effective immediately, all recruitment within the Fieldworks Division is paused, including backfills and contractor extensions. Offers already signed will be honoured. Internal transfers require divisional sign-off. This measure follows the mid-year review and is expected to last one quarter, subject to reassessment. Please route any exception requests through your regional lead. The underlying business rationale is set out in the note below.

confidential, yahof-hahig: The finance team signed off on a budget of $169.6 million for Project Julox.

## Local Setup: Watchdog

Plugin authors building for the Bramblecart kiosk should run the watchdog locally before testing. The watchdog restarts the shell if a plugin blocks the render loop for more than four seconds, and it records every restart with the offending plugin's manifest name. These records are written to the watchdog's event store, which must be running before the kiosk launches. Configure the event store with the connection string below.

primary connection of yagep-kahip = redis://giliel_svc:zYiKsLL2PLpfPL@db-348f.xolmarsys.corp:5432/fenwyn

## TileCache Layer

Vexmap's tile renderer sits behind TileCache, an LRU layer keyed by zoom, coordinates, and style hash. Reviews touching the renderer must confirm cache keys change whenever output changes — stale tiles are our top bug source. Eviction is size-based; TTL is a fallback only. Never bypass the cache in production paths. Key derivation rules and invalidation procedures are documented on the internal design page.

runbook for badug-kadup: https://confluence.zemvarlabs.internal/projects/browse/display/projects/bd1b